Saint Michael

Saint Michael is a Japanese streetwear brand characterized by a vintage-inspired aesthetic and religious iconography. The label emphasizes a distressed, worn-in look achieved through specialized manufacturing processes. Its ethos centers on spiritual themes and the subculture of high-end, artisanal graphic apparel.

Fashion History

Founded in 2020 by Yuta Hosokawa of Ready-made and artist Cali Thornhill Dewitt, Saint Michael emerged as a collaboration between Japanese design and Los Angeles-based artistry. The brand gained cultural significance for its meticulous aging techniques, which replicate the texture and feel of authentic vintage garments. It occupies a specific niche in fashion history by merging contemporary streetwear silhouettes with traditional screen-printing methods and theological imagery, influencing the trend of luxury distressed clothing.
